High-Performance Laminar Flow Hoods & Cabinets

In research settings, maintaining a sterile environment is paramount for accurate results. High-performance laminar flow hoods and cabinets provide a controlled airflow pattern that effectively removes airborne contaminants, safeguarding experiments and samples from contaminating influences. These units are frequently employed in fields such as pharmaceuticals, biotechnology, and healthcare, where contamination can have significant consequences.

The operation of a laminar flow hood relies on a HEPA-filtered air stream that flows in a unidirectional manner, creating a clean workspace above the work surface. This ensures that particles are constantly moved away from the working area, preventing contamination of samples and equipment.

  • Moreover, high-performance laminar flow hoods often feature advanced capabilities, such as adjustable airflow velocities, UV sterilization options, and integrated safety devices to enhance user protection.
  • When selecting a laminar flow hood, it is crucial to consider the specific needs of your tasks. Factors such as airflow velocity, workspace size, and filter efficiency should be carefully evaluated to ensure optimal performance and safety.
